Electrical substation solutions come in various forms, each designed to address specific operational challenges while improving performance and safety. For instance, traditional substations are often large and labor-intensive, requiring significant real estate and ongoing maintenance. However, newer designs, such as modular substations, offer a compact and efficient alternative. These prefabricated systems can be easily transported and rapidly deployed, providing flexibility to operators who need to adapt to changing demands.
One of the standout innovations in electrical substation solutions is the development of digital substations. These facilities utilize advanced monitoring and control technologies to provide real-time data analytics. By integrating Internet of Things (IoT) devices, utilities can gain visibility into system performance, predict potential issues before they escalate, and optimize maintenance schedules. This proactive approach not only reduces downtime but also enhances the overall reliability of the power supply.
Moreover, the shift towards renewable energy sources is reshaping the landscape of electrical substations. With the integration of solar, wind, and energy storage systems, the design and operation of substations must adapt. Smart grid technologies, which include advanced sensors and automated communication protocols, facilitate the seamless integration of these renewable sources into the existing grid. These electrical substation solutions not only accommodate fluctuating power generation but also help in balancing supply and demand more effectively.
Safety is another critical factor in the evolution of electrical substation solutions. Recent advancements have led to the implementation of more robust safety measures, such as enhanced insulation materials and advanced protection systems that minimize the risk of failures and accidents. The combination of smart technology and improved safety protocols ensures that substations can operate reliably in diverse environmental conditions, which is essential as climate change poses new challenges to energy infrastructure.
In addition to technological advancements, sustainability is becoming increasingly important in the design of electrical substations. Many utilities are now pursuing green substation solutions, which include the use of environmentally friendly materials, designs that minimize land use, and systems that reduce electromagnetic fields. These solutions not only contribute to lower carbon footprints but also align with the sustainability goals of many organizations.
The implementation of electrical substation solutions must also consider future scalability. As energy demands continue to increase, substations need the capability to expand without significant overhauls. Modular and digital designs inherently support this flexibility, allowing utilities to add components, increase capacity, or make technological upgrades with minimal interruption to service.
